引言
在当今互联网环境中,网络隐私和安全显得尤为重要。Shadowsocks作为一种高效的代理工具,已经被广泛应用于网络访问的隐私保护。而Merlin固件是对路由器进行深度定制的一种选择,可以使用户更方便地使用Shadowsocks。本文将深入探讨GitHub上Shadowsocks Merlin的使用与配置,帮助用户更好地理解和利用这一工具。
什么是Shadowsocks?
Shadowsocks是一种开源代理工具,最初由一名中国程序员开发,旨在帮助用户突破网络审查。它采用了SOCKS5协议,通过加密和转发网络流量,使用户可以安全、匿名地浏览互联网。Shadowsocks的优势在于:
- 高效:较低的延迟和快速的连接速度
- 安全:支持多种加密算法,保护用户数据
- 灵活性:可以根据需要自定义配置
什么是Merlin固件?
Merlin固件是对ASUS路由器官方固件的增强版,提供了更多的功能和选项。它不仅支持Shadowsocks,还可以通过简单的图形界面进行配置和管理。使用Merlin固件,用户可以享受到以下优点:
- 丰富的功能:支持VPN、Adblock、QoS等功能
- 稳定性:经过优化的固件,提供更好的稳定性
- 开源社区:可以获得更多的支持和更新
如何安装Merlin固件?
在使用Shadowsocks之前,首先需要安装Merlin固件。以下是安装步骤:
- 下载Merlin固件:访问GitHub Merlin Releases下载适合您路由器型号的固件。
- 备份当前设置:在路由器的管理界面中,备份当前的设置,以防需要恢复。
- 刷入固件:登录路由器管理界面,选择“固件升级”选项,上传下载的Merlin固件进行刷入。
- 重启路由器:固件刷入完成后,重启路由器以使新固件生效。
在Merlin上配置Shadowsocks
配置Shadowsocks可以通过Merlin的图形界面进行,步骤如下:
- 访问路由器管理界面:使用浏览器输入路由器的IP地址(默认一般为192.168.1.1)进行登录。
- 找到Shadowsocks设置:在左侧菜单中找到“VPN”选项,再点击“Shadowsocks”进入配置界面。
- 填写服务器信息:在配置页面中,填写Shadowsocks服务器的IP地址和端口,以及加密方式和密码。
- 保存设置:填写完成后,点击“保存”按钮,确保设置被保存。
- 启动Shadowsocks:在设置完成后,选择“启用”Shadowsocks功能。
常见问题解答
1. 如何选择合适的Shadowsocks服务器?
选择合适的Shadowsocks服务器非常重要。您可以考虑以下几个因素:
- 速度:选择距离较近的服务器通常能提供更快的连接速度。
- 稳定性:查找用户评价较好的服务器,确保其稳定性。
- 隐私政策:选择提供良好隐私保护政策的服务商。
2. 为什么Shadowsocks无法连接?
如果遇到连接问题,可以尝试以下几种方法:
- 检查网络:确认您的互联网连接正常。
- 验证服务器信息:再次检查填写的服务器地址和端口是否正确。
- 切换服务器:如果某个服务器无法连接,可以尝试其他服务器。
3. 使用Shadowsocks是否合法?
Shadowsocks本身是一种工具,其合法性取决于您所处国家和地区的法律法规。在某些地方使用此工具可能会面临法律风险,请务必自行了解当地法律。
4. Merlin固件如何更新?
- 手动更新:访问GitHub Merlin Releases下载最新版本,重复安装步骤。
- 自动更新:在Merlin的设置中,有时会提供自动更新选项,方便用户获取最新的固件。
结论
通过本文的介绍,我们深入探讨了GitHub上Shadowsocks Merlin的使用与配置,了解了如何安装Merlin固件、配置Shadowsocks以及常见问题的解决方案。希望这篇文章能帮助用户更好地理解和使用这些网络工具,保护个人隐私,实现自由的网络访问。